
Improvised Windsock
Alfredo Alan, drone pilot at Universidad de Costa Rica, improvises a windsock with a grocery bag and a pole during the CRATER campaign. CRATER (Costa Rica Airborne research on foresT Ecosystem Response to volcanic emissions), is a NASA-led project investigating the use of an uncrewed aircraft for volcanic trace gas sampling, in order to better understand the impact of carbon dioxide emissions on vegetation.
